...a practical, hands-on guide for anyone directing and producing a play by, with, for or about lesbians by a woman who has been involved in every aspect of lesbian theater. Feminist Bookstore News Geared to the fledgling lesbian director and producer, Gage's handbook is chock-full of new ideas and common sense about choosing, mounting, publicizing, and surviving the live theatre experience...crack's open the mysteries of the successful theatrical venture. Most important, the book addresses the complex underpinnings of accountability, leadership, and collaboration in the differently structured world of women-run groups...two chapters on victims and leadership deliver such savvy and sage advice that they should be required reading for all women who work in organizations...even while preoccupied with basics, Gage doesn't neglect the artistic/spiritual aspects of why we do theatre in the first place... Take Stage! really does deliver what it promises: to take the inexperienced director and producer through all stages of production...rejoice that a real resource guide is available, one that is concise, readable, and inspiring.
